Linea

Come faccio a mantenere la nuova riga/interruzione di riga/fine riga in un file coerente su Mac e Windows?

Come faccio a mantenere la nuova riga/interruzione di riga/fine riga in un file coerente su Mac e Windows?
  1. Perché avere una nuova riga alla fine del file??
  2. Come aggiungo un nuovo carattere di riga a un file di testo??
  3. Come posso cambiare le interruzioni di riga da CRLF a LF??
  4. Che cos'è il delimitatore CR LF??
  5. Cosa non è una nuova riga alla fine del file??
  6. Come posso correggere l'avviso di non ritorno a capo alla fine del file??
  7. Qual è il nuovo comando di linea??
  8. Come si inserisce un'interruzione di riga nel testo??
  9. Che cos'è un feed di riga in un file di testo??
  10. Come posso cambiare una riga alla fine in Linux??
  11. Come posso cambiare la fine della riga di Windows in Unix??
  12. Che cos'è LF e CRLF nel codice VS??

Perché avere una nuova riga alla fine del file??

Se il contenuto viene aggiunto alla fine del file, la riga che in precedenza era l'ultima riga sarà stata modificata per includere un carattere di nuova riga. Ciò significa che dare la colpa al file per scoprire quando quella riga è stata modificata l'ultima volta mostrerà l'aggiunta di testo, non il commit prima di quello che volevi effettivamente vedere.

Come aggiungo un nuovo carattere di riga a un file di testo??

LF (carattere: \n, Unicode: U+000A, ASCII: 10, esadecimale: 0x0a): questo è semplicemente il carattere '\n' che tutti conosciamo dai nostri primi giorni di programmazione. Questo carattere è comunemente noto come "Avanzamento riga" o "Carattere di nuova riga".

Come posso cambiare le interruzioni di riga da CRLF a LF??

In basso a destra dello schermo in VS Code, fai clic sul piccolo pulsante che dice LF o CRLF . Dopo averlo modificato secondo le tue preferenze, Voilà, il file che stai modificando ora ha le interruzioni di riga corrette correct.

Che cos'è il delimitatore CR LF??

CR e LF sono caratteri di controllo o bytecode che possono essere utilizzati per contrassegnare un'interruzione di riga in un file di testo. CR = Ritorno a capo ( \r , 0x0D in esadecimale, 13 in decimale): sposta il cursore all'inizio della riga senza passare alla riga successiva.

Cosa non è una nuova riga alla fine del file??

Indica che non hai una nuova riga (di solito '\n' , alias CR o CRLF) alla fine del file. Cioè, semplicemente parlando, l'ultimo byte (o byte se sei su Windows) nel file non è una nuova riga.

Come posso correggere l'avviso di non ritorno a capo alla fine del file??

newline non l'ultimo carattere nel file Tipo: Avvertimento Ogni file sorgente e intestazione non vuoti deve essere costituito da righe complete. Questa diagnostica avverte che l'ultima riga di un file non è terminata con una nuova riga. Puoi semplicemente correggere questo avviso aggiungendo una nuova riga alla fine dei tuoi file sorgente e file di intestazione.

Qual è il nuovo comando di linea??

I sistemi operativi hanno caratteri speciali che indicano l'inizio di una nuova riga. Ad esempio, in Linux una nuova riga è indicata da "\n", chiamata anche Line Feed. In Windows, una nuova riga viene indicata utilizzando "\r\n", talvolta chiamato Ritorno a capo e Avanzamento riga, o CRLF.

Come si inserisce un'interruzione di riga nel testo??

Quando viene inserita un'interruzione di riga il cursore si sposta in basso di una singola riga, che è diversa dal paragrafo che termina il paragrafo e ne inizia uno nuovo. Quando tieni premuto Maiusc e premi Invio viene inserito un tag di interruzione di riga ( <br /> ) e il testo inserito dopo l'interruzione di riga apparirà nella riga successiva in basso.

Che cos'è un feed di riga in un file di testo??

Nuova riga (spesso chiamata fine riga, fine riga (EOL), avanzamento riga o interruzione riga) è un carattere di controllo o una sequenza di caratteri di controllo in una specifica di codifica dei caratteri (e.g. ASCII o EBCDIC) che viene utilizzato per indicare la fine di una riga di testo e l'inizio di una nuova.

Come posso cambiare una riga alla fine in Linux??

Converti le terminazioni di riga da CR/LF a un singolo LF: modifica il file con Vim, dai il comando :set ff=unix e salva il file. Ricodifica ora dovrebbe essere eseguito senza errori.

Come posso cambiare la fine della riga di Windows in Unix??

Per scrivere il tuo file in questo modo, mentre hai il file aperto, vai al menu Modifica, seleziona il sottomenu "Conversione EOL" e dalle opzioni che appaiono seleziona "Formato UNIX/OSX". La prossima volta che salverai il file, le sue terminazioni di riga verranno, tutto andando bene, salvate con terminazioni di riga in stile UNIX.

Che cos'è LF e CRLF nel codice VS??

Ciò è in genere dovuto a una differenza nelle terminazioni di riga, principalmente la differenza di LF vs CRLF . I sistemi Unix (Linux e MacOS) utilizzano di default il carattere LF (line feed) per le interruzioni di riga. Windows d'altra parte è speciale e utilizza CR/LF (ritorno a capo AND avanzamento riga) per impostazione predefinita.

Il vecchio MacBook Pro non vede il nuovo altoparlante Bluetooth moderno, perché no??
Perché il mio Mac non trova il mio altoparlante Bluetooth?? Come aggiungo un nuovo dispositivo Bluetooth al mio Mac?? I MacBook Pro hanno il Bluetooth...
Come rimuovere il dispositivo Bluetooth facendo clic su x quando non c'è x?
Come faccio a forzare l'eliminazione di un dispositivo Bluetooth?? Come faccio a forzare il mio Mac a rimuovere un dispositivo Bluetooth?? Come rimuov...
Come risolvere i problemi del bluetooth su Catalina 10.15.4?
Come posso risolvere il problema Bluetooth di macOS Catalina?? Come posso risolvere la disconnessione Bluetooth sul mio Macbook Pro?? Come posso ripri...